The Crucial Role of Brake Fluid
Brake fluid is a specialized hydraulic fluid designed to withstand the high pressures and temperatures generated within the braking system. It is a non-compressible fluid, meaning its volume remains relatively constant under pressure. This property is essential for efficient brake operation, as it ensures that the force applied to the brake pedal is transmitted directly to the brake calipers.
Composition and Properties
Brake fluid is typically composed of glycol ethers, which provide excellent hydraulic properties and resistance to corrosion. It also contains additives to enhance its performance, such as anti-wear agents, anti-foaming agents, and corrosion inhibitors. The specific composition of brake fluid varies depending on the manufacturer and the intended application.
Brake fluid must possess several key properties to function effectively:
- High boiling point: To prevent vapor lock, a condition where the brake fluid boils under high pressure, resulting in a loss of braking efficiency.
- Low freezing point: To ensure that the brake fluid remains fluid in cold temperatures, preventing the system from seizing up.
- Excellent lubricity: To reduce friction within the brake system, extending the life of components.
- Corrosion resistance: To protect metal parts from rust and degradation.
Types of Brake Fluid
Brake fluids are classified into different types based on their performance characteristics and boiling points. The most common types are:
- DOT 3: A standard brake fluid with a boiling point of around 205°C (401°F).
- DOT 4: A higher-performance brake fluid with a boiling point of around 230°C (446°F).
- DOT 5: A silicone-based brake fluid with a very high boiling point (over 260°C or 500°F) but is not compatible with DOT 3 or DOT 4 systems.
- DOT 5.1: A glycol-ether-based brake fluid with a boiling point similar to DOT 4.
The Dangers of Running Low on Brake Fluid
Running low on brake fluid can have catastrophic consequences for your safety and the safety of others on the road. The severity of the issue depends on the amount of fluid lost and the specific condition of your braking system. (See Also: How to Measure Brake Shoes? Properly And Safely)
Reduced Braking Performance
As brake fluid levels drop, the hydraulic pressure within the system decreases, resulting in a softer brake pedal feel and reduced braking power. This can make it more difficult to stop your vehicle in a timely manner, especially at higher speeds.
Spongy Brake Pedal
A spongy brake pedal is a clear indication of low brake fluid. It feels soft and compressible, as if you’re pushing on a cushion. This indicates that the brake lines are not filled with sufficient fluid, leading to a loss of pressure and braking efficiency.
Brake Fade
Brake fade occurs when the brake system overheats and the brake fluid’s boiling point is reached. This causes the fluid to vaporize, creating air bubbles in the lines. These air bubbles compress easily under pressure, reducing braking effectiveness.
Complete Brake Failure
In the worst-case scenario, running out of brake fluid entirely can lead to complete brake failure. This means that your brakes will no longer function, leaving you with no way to stop your vehicle. This is a life-threatening situation that can result in serious accidents.
What to Do if You Run Out of Brake Fluid
If you suspect that you are running low on brake fluid, it is crucial to address the issue immediately. Driving with insufficient brake fluid is extremely dangerous and should be avoided at all costs.
Pull Over Safely
The first and most important step is to pull over to a safe location as soon as possible. Avoid driving at high speeds or in heavy traffic. If you can’t safely pull over, try to coast to a stop in a controlled manner.
Check the Brake Fluid Reservoir
Locate the brake fluid reservoir, which is usually a clear plastic container with a minimum and maximum fluid level markings. Check the fluid level and note any leaks or discoloration. (See Also: What Holds the Brake Fluid in a Car? – The Hidden Secrets)
Do Not Add Fluid if There is a Leak
If you find a leak, do not attempt to add more brake fluid. This will only worsen the situation. Instead, have your vehicle towed to a qualified mechanic for diagnosis and repair.
Call for Roadside Assistance
If you are unable to safely diagnose or repair the issue yourself, call for roadside assistance. They can help you tow your vehicle to a mechanic or provide temporary assistance.
Have Your Vehicle Inspected by a Mechanic
Once your vehicle is safely at a mechanic’s shop, have them inspect the entire braking system for leaks, damage, or other problems. They will also top off the brake fluid reservoir to the correct level.
FAQs
What happens if I drive with low brake fluid?
Driving with low brake fluid can significantly reduce your braking performance, making it harder to stop your vehicle effectively. This can lead to accidents and injuries. It is crucial to address low brake fluid levels immediately.
How often should I check my brake fluid?
It is recommended to check your brake fluid level at least once a month, or more frequently if you drive in harsh conditions. Always refer to your vehicle’s owner’s manual for specific maintenance schedules.
Can I top off my brake fluid myself?
Yes, you can top off your brake fluid yourself, but it is important to use the correct type of fluid for your vehicle. Always refer to your owner’s manual for the recommended type and specifications. Be careful not to overfill the reservoir.
What are the signs of brake fluid leaks?
Signs of brake fluid leaks include a low brake fluid level, a spongy brake pedal, brake fluid stains on the ground, or a burning smell near the brakes. (See Also: Why Are My Brake Rotors Rusty? Causes Revealed)
What should I do if I suspect a brake fluid leak?
If you suspect a brake fluid leak, do not drive your vehicle. Have it towed to a qualified mechanic for diagnosis and repair. Driving with a brake fluid leak can be extremely dangerous.
